The New York State Human Rights Law and the federal Fair Housing Act prohibit discrimination in the sale, rental, advertising, financing, or appraisal of housing on the basis of:
Real estate brokers, salespersons, and their employees are required to comply with the Fair Housing Act and the New York State Human Rights Law in all real estate transactions — including the showing, sale, rental, financing, and advertising of housing, and all dealings with potential buyers, sellers, tenants, and landlords.
If you believe you have been the subject of unlawful housing discrimination, contact one of the agencies below. A complaint may be filed at no cost.
